Understanding the Crash Game Phenomenon
Crash games are a relatively new addition to the online casino landscape, characterized by their simplicity and fast-paced action. The core idea revolves around a multiplier that starts at 1x and increases exponentially as time progresses. Players place a bet before each round, and the goal is to ‘cash out’ before the multiplier ‘crashes’ – that is, before the game randomly ends. The longer you wait, the higher the multiplier, and the greater your potential payout. However, the risk increases proportionally with time; the crash could occur at any moment. This element of chance and the potential for quick wins are key components of their popularity.

The Importance of Provably Fair Technology
In the realm of online gaming, trust is paramount. Provably Fair technology is a system that allows players to verify the fairness of each game round. This is achieved through cryptographic techniques that ensure the game’s results are not manipulated by the operator. This system typically involves the use of a seed generated by both the server and the client, combined to create a hash result that determines the outcome. Players can independently verify this hash and confirm that the outcome was random and unbiased.
Provably Fair is an essential feature for any reputable crash game platform. It provides transparency and assurance to players, fostering trust and demonstrating a commitment to integrity. Without this assurance, players have no way of knowing whether the game is genuinely random or rigged.
